Lenovo Group CFO Wai Ming Wong detailed the company's intensified capital expenditure plans for artificial intelligence infrastructure in a June 27, 2026, Bloomberg Odd Lots podcast interview. The strategic shift allocates an additional $3 billion over the next two years to AI-optimized data centers and next-generation PC development. This investment represents a 40% increase over the firm’s historical capex average, signaling a fundamental reallocation of resources to capture the burgeoning AI hardware market. The announcement provides a critical blueprint for how legacy hardware manufacturers are adapting their financial strategies in the AI age.
The PC industry is undergoing its most significant transformation since the shift to mobile computing. After a multi-year slump driven by post-pandemic demand normalization, generative AI has created a new upgrade cycle. The proliferation of large language models requires immense computational power at both the data center and edge device levels. This dual demand is forcing hardware leaders to invest heavily to avoid obsolescence.
Lenovo's last major capex cycle occurred in 2021, targeting $2.1 billion to expand manufacturing capacity for the remote work boom. The current commitment is substantially larger and focused on a different technological frontier. The timing is critical, as rivals like Dell and HP Inc. have also signaled increased AI-related spending, setting the stage for a capital-intensive competitive battle.
Current monetary policy, with the Federal Funds Rate at 5.25-5.50%, makes this level of investment more costly to finance. This underscores management's conviction in the long-term return profile of AI infrastructure. The catalyst is the commercial viability of on-device AI processors, which allows companies like Lenovo to differentiate their products beyond traditional specifications.
The announced $3 billion capex program will be deployed between fiscal years 2026 and 2028. This elevates Lenovo's projected annual capex-to-revenue ratio to approximately 4.5%, a significant jump from its 10-year average of 3.2%. For comparison, NVIDIA's capex-to-revenue ratio exceeded 6% in its last fiscal year, while Dell's stood at 2.1%.
A key allocation breakdown highlights the strategic priorities.
| Investment Area | Allocation (%) | Primary Use Case |
|---|---|---|
| AI Server Manufacturing | 50% | High-performance computing systems |
| R&D for AI PCs | 30% | On-device neural processing units |
| Advanced Supply Chain | 20% | Co-investment with chip suppliers |
This investment aims to double Lenovo's AI server revenue to over $15 billion annually by 2028. The company's traditional PC business generated $49 billion in revenue for its last fiscal year, illustrating the growth potential management sees in enterprise AI.
This capex plan creates direct tailwinds for semiconductor capital equipment providers. Companies like ASML and Applied Materials will see sustained demand from memory and logic chip manufacturers supplying Lenovo. AI server component suppliers, including NVIDIA for GPUs and Super Micro Computer for modular systems, are positioned for continued订单 growth. The investment also validates the thesis that enterprise AI adoption is moving from cloud-centric to a hybrid model, benefiting edge computing infrastructure firms.
A significant risk is the potential for a capex arms race leading to industry-wide oversupply. If AI adoption curves slow, manufacturers could be left with excess capacity, pressuring margins. Lenovo's operating margin for its last quarter was 4.8%, which could be vulnerable if the ROI on this spending is delayed.

Lenovo's $3 billion commitment is more concentrated and aggressive than Dell's announced initiatives. Dell has emphasized software and services integration alongside hardware, with a less defined total capex figure. Lenovo's plan is heavily weighted toward physical manufacturing and supply chain co-investment, indicating a bet on owning more of the AI hardware stack. This difference in strategy will test which approach garners greater market share in the evolving AI server landscape.
Initial AI PC models are expected to carry a price premium of 10-15% over comparable non-AI devices. Lenovo's CFO indicated that economies of scale from this capex investment aim to reduce that premium to 5-7% within 18 months. The goal is to make the technology accessible to the mass market, driving upgrade cycles similar to the transition from HDD to SSD storage.
